Why learn this

71% of business leaders would rather hire the less experienced person with AI skills than the more experienced one without.

Whether you use ChatGPT, Claude, Gemini or Grok, the evidence points one way: people who put generative AI to work finish more work, do better work, and are the people business leaders now say they would hire first.

  • 71%

    Hiring has already turned

    Microsoft and LinkedIn asked business leaders in 2024: 71% would rather take a less experienced person with AI skills than a more experienced one without, and 66% would not hire someone without them at all.

    Microsoft and LinkedIn, Work Trend Index 2024
  • 40%

    Better work, not just faster work

    More than 700 consultants in a Harvard and BCG experiment produced work nearly 40% better with GPT-4, OpenAI's most capable model at the time, on tasks it is good at, and worse on tasks it is not.

    MIT Sloan on the Harvard and BCG field experiment
  • 34%

    Beginners gain the most

    5,179 customer support agents were given a generative AI assistant in a Stanford and MIT study. Output rose 14% on average, and 34% for the newest workers, the biggest lift in the study.

    Brynjolfsson, Li and Raymond, Generative AI at Work
  • 62%

    The pay gap is open and widening

    PwC's 2026 Global AI Jobs Barometer: jobs asking for AI skills pay 62% more on average than the same job without them, up from 57% the year before, and they are growing more than seven times as fast as the jobs market.

    PwC, Global AI Jobs Barometer 2026

The above four studies point the same way: people who get real work out of these tools come out ahead. The skill of doing that on purpose is called prompt engineering: no code, just knowing what to ask, what to trust, how to measure, and where the machine stops being good. What makes this different

Most AI tips are made up. You will learn to test them.

Most AI courses hand you a list of magic phrases. Most of those phrases do not survive testing. This course teaches you to test them yourself, on a spreadsheet, with an account you already have.

That includes the big names. One of the most taken AI courses in the world, more than 700,000 learners enrolled, teaches "give the AI a persona" as one of its first techniques. When researchers tested 162 personas on 2,410 questions across four families of models, the personas did not improve the answers. Every technique taught here comes with the test that shows whether it holds.
